Input Range and Output Range
Select Input Range or Output Range from the System Settings page to set the voltage range
at either +20 dBu or +26 dBu. Apply the settings globally by highlighting “Set All Voltage
Ranges to +20 dBu” (or +26 dBu) and pressing the Enter button.
Adjust the individual input or output voltage range for each channel by scrolling to the desired
channel using the Up and Down arrows, and then pressing or turning the Blue knob to toggle
between the two values.
NOTE:
The adjustable output range provides two level output settings to drive
Meyer Sound self-powered products. The +20 dBu output range setting lowers
the overall noise floor by nearly 6 dB. However, this setting makes the Galileo output
signal more vulnerable to defects in the overall grounding system. Thus the actual
improvement attained depends on the quality of the grounding between components.
For this reason, the default setting is +26 dBu. In either setting, the digital gain will
compensate for either analog output gain so that the overall system output level set in
Galileo will remain the same.
